The bachelor's program at UNCA was ranked #152 on College Factual's Best Schools for engineering list. It is also ranked #5 in North Carolina.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, University of North Carolina at Asheville handed out 28 bachelor's degrees in general engineering. This is a decrease of 26% over the previous year when 38 degrees were handed out.
Engineering majors who earn their bachelor's degree from UNCA go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$62,948 a year. This is higher than $61,282, which is the national median for all engineering bachelor's degree recipients.
While getting their bachelor's degree at UNCA, engineering students borrow a median amount of $31,000 in student loans. This is higher than the the typical median of $26,000 for all engineering majors across the country.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the engineering majors at University of North Carolina at Asheville.
Of the 28 engineering students who graduated with a bachelor's degree in 2020-2021 from UNCA, about 86% were men and 14% were women.
The majority of bachelor's degree recipients in this major at UNCA are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 79% of students fell into this category.
